Frequently asked questions about night-shift vacancies
With a fixed night shift, you work consistently during the night, usually between 10 pm and 6 am, on a fixed timetable. This differs from rotating shifts: you know in advance when you’re working and when you’re off.
Night work is most common in logistics, warehousing and transport. Examples include warehouses that process orders at night, transport companies that schedule night-time deliveries, and operational teams that continue to work outside office hours.
For people who prefer to work at night rather than during the day, or who want to keep their days free for family, studies or other activities. A fixed night-time routine requires discipline, but in return offers a predictable schedule.
Think of planners, dispatchers, team leaders and warehouse staff who work specifically on the night shift, but also managerial roles such as operations manager, where you oversee night-time operations.
